Hello Aspirant,
See if you are seeking admission to Undergraduate courses offered in IISC then there are different channels such as KVPY, IIT-JEE (Main and Advanced) and NEET through which you can take entry into IISC and the institution has clearly mentioned that "Students desirous of applying to the Bachelor of Science (Research) Programme must take at least one of the above examinations."
So if you clear JEE-Main but unable to clear JEE-Advance then also you can apply through your JEE-Main score but note that you should qualify the certain eligibility criteria which you can check from the official website of IISC, which is given below :-

Indian Institute of Science (IISc), Bangalore was established in the year 1909 by the Indian Government. IISc was started with the joint efforts of Jamsetji Nussarwanji Tata, the Government of India and the Maharaja of Mysore.
The basic criterion for admission to IISc through JEE Mains is getting a minimum percentage of scores.
60% translating to 216/360 for general
54% translating to 195/360 for OBC-NCL
30% translating to 108/360 for SC/ST
However the cut-offs are way higher.
Year 2015:
General 325
OBC-NCL 250 -> 194
SC 220
ST 108
And everyone getting selected, regardless of category, having less than 285 marks need to attend an interview.
Year 2014:
General 295
OBC-NCL 204 -> 215 -> 196
SC 108 -> 160 -> 108
ST 108
And everyone getting selected, regardless of category, having less than 275 marks need to attend an interview.
All those satisfying the necessary cut off and scoring above the minimum marks, are guaranteed admission. Others after clearing interview can be admitted.
If the seats reserved to be filled through JEE Mains is not fully filled, there is a chance for the cut-off to be lowered during subsequent counseling sessions.
